Utilizing Technology

One of the key best practices for efficient inventory control in hospitals is utilizing technology. Automated inventory management systems can streamline processes, improve accuracy, and reduce manual errors. These systems can help track inventory levels in real-time, generate automated alerts for low stock, and provide data analytics for better decision-making.

Benefits of Technology in Inventory Control

  1. Real-time tracking of inventory levels
  2. Automated alerts for low stock
  3. Data analytics for better decision-making

Implementation Tips

  1. Invest in a reliable inventory management system
  2. Train staff on how to use the system effectively
  3. Regularly update and maintain the technology to ensure optimal performance

Standardizing Processes

Another best practice for implementing inventory control systems in hospitals is standardizing processes. Standardization helps create consistency, reduces inefficiencies, and improves accuracy in managing supplies and equipment. By establishing clear guidelines and protocols for inventory control, hospitals can minimize errors, prevent stockouts, and maintain optimal inventory levels.

Benefits of Standardization

  1. Consistency in inventory management processes
  2. Reduced inefficiencies and errors
  3. Optimal inventory levels maintained

Implementation Tips

  1. Create standardized procedures for ordering, receiving, storing, and dispensing inventory
  2. Ensure staff compliance with established protocols through training and monitoring
  3. Regularly review and update standardized processes to adapt to changing needs

Fostering Collaboration Among Departments

Collaboration among departments is another critical best practice for efficient inventory control in hospitals. By fostering communication and teamwork between departments such as Supply Chain, nursing, and finance, hospitals can improve coordination, enhance inventory visibility, and optimize resource allocation. Working together towards common goals can lead to better decision-making and improved overall efficiency.

Benefits of Collaboration

  1. Improved coordination and communication
  2. Enhanced inventory visibility
  3. Optimized resource allocation

Implementation Tips

  1. Establish cross-functional teams to oversee inventory control processes
  2. Encourage open communication and collaboration between departments
  3. Utilize technology platforms for sharing real-time inventory data across departments
